Traditional vs. Technology-Enhanced Merchandise
The evolution of World Cup merchandise reflects broader changes in sports marketing and fan interaction. Historically, merchandise primarily served as a means of showing allegiance through visible team colors and logos. Today, the focus has shifted towards creating immersive experiences and offering products that extend beyond mere apparel, incorporating elements of digital integration and personalized engagement.

Merchandise Accessibility and Global Reach
The global nature of the World Cup necessitates a robust distribution and accessibility strategy for merchandise. The advent of e-commerce and international shipping has revolutionized how fans worldwide can acquire official products, contrasting sharply with pre-internet limitations.
